The Science

What Your Finger
Reveals.

Clinical medicine has long used visual finger examination as a diagnostic aid. AETERNO AI applies machine vision to these same established clinical markers — at scale, instantly, from your smartphone camera.

🩷
Nail Bed Colour
Pink nail beds indicate healthy circulation. Pallor may signal anaemia or low haemoglobin. Blue tones can indicate oxygen saturation concerns. Yellow may suggest liver or fungal signals.
📏
Nail Shape & Ridging
Longitudinal ridges are often associated with nutritional deficiencies (iron, zinc, B12). Clubbing can indicate respiratory or cardiovascular conditions. Spooning may suggest iron deficiency anaemia.
🌡️
Capillary Patterns
Visible capillaries and micro-vascular patterns around the nail fold can signal autoimmune, inflammatory or circulatory conditions. Their visibility, density and regularity all carry clinical significance.
🔬
Skin Tone & Hydration
Skin colour uniformity, dryness, and texture around the finger provide indicators of metabolic health, thyroid function, hydration status and inflammatory markers.
💧
Cuticle Health
Cuticle condition, ragged edges, and peeling skin around the nail can indicate nutritional deficiencies, inflammatory conditions, or autoimmune signals such as lupus erythematosus.
🎨
Colour Symmetry
Asymmetry in colour between fingers or zones within the nail bed can indicate localised circulatory issues, nerve compression, or Raynaud's phenomenon — all flagged by AI analysis.
